Anyone know of any good perf parts that will fit a 1982 trimoto 175????

Dan10
08-27-2004, 02:59 PM
There are mods out there, but finding them can be difficult. DG made a head for these, but a more feasible option would be to run an IT175 head. I picked one up on e-bay for $5. Havent run it yet, but is supposed to raise compression slightly. two types of performance exhaust, bassani, and I think DG. I have a new unused durablue +6 rear axle. A protec rear suspension kit. An IT175 boost bootle and intake. Not sure if the IT175 carb is bigger, but that may help along with a K&N filter. Not sure if a port job would be worth the money, but could be another option.

Man I tried this ... well sorta ...
see the thing is the blaster has a long stroke with the same bore soo well theres no point unless you can change the rods.... the piston is the same bore .. the skirt is a little like maybe 1 or 2 mm longer on the blaster piston. umm so well i guess you could run a blaster piston ... i dont think it would do much though .. but i thought about a 240kit for the yt!!! .. it wont be a 240cc buy maybe like umm 220 or so!!! I got hodwy to check the cylinders and on the yt the studs are bigger .. but he said the base gaskets are almost identical... this is a possibility .. if someone could figure out a fix for the stroke... maybe like plain the head like 10mm lol i dunno.

Ok I looked around and found some info.
The motor for the blaster was in production as the IT175, they just put a bigger stroke in it and made it 200cc. So I quess the IT head won't work.
And it seems like all the bottom ends might have the same engine mount location. So a blaster motor or IT motor might bolt up into a YT frame hopefully.
